This is the fourth book in The England Story Series covering the period from 1949 to 2014. Unlike its predecessors this book covers a region of London instead of a club. The A-Z format remains the same for each club but this book covers the careers of footballers who have played for England while playing for Chelsea, Fulham or Queens Park Rangers. Chronologically the Chelsea story starts with Roy Bentley, the first player from a London club to score in the World Cup. The Fulham section only comprises four players but includes an England Captain and a World Cup winner. The Queens Park Rangers section commences in the 1970's and particularly reflects Rangers heyday in the middle of that decade. There is also a shorter version of this book covering just Chelsea.
